> What was left on the floor after removing the carpets was asbestos tile -
> and I wasn't going to try and remove it, not with two small kids in the
> house.  The experts we talked to said that the Pergo flooring would be more
> than sufficient to encapsulate the tile and contain the asbestos.

My folks have asbestos tile in their kitchen.  The general ruling is that it's a
non-friable asbestos, and is thus safe if it's not damaged or badly disturbed,
so I'd imagine that with the floating pergo you're more than safe.
